Assumptions

Assumptions are ideas we believe without actually knowing them to be true.

What are some other groups of people you have heard assumptions made about?

Why do you think assumptions are made?

Is it bad to be different?

Identity

Identity is what makes us who we are...Some aspects of our identity stay the same over time. Others change as we get older. Your identity is a snapshot of who you are right now.
